Abstract

This article is a case study focused on a music conservatory in southern Spain regarding the implications of the female gender in the academic and professional performance of music students. Through study of data from the Ministry of Culture, the center’s secretariat and a more extensive survey carried out on the promotions of students who have completed their studies, it has been possible to observe a number of aspects showing a series of significant differences in terms of academic and professional performance between male and female music students, without concluding there is real discrimination
